What is Boiling Waterproof (BWP) Plywood?

Boiling Waterproof (BWP) plywood is a type of plywood that is specifically designed to withstand extreme moisture and water exposure. It is manufactured using high-quality hardwood veneers and phenolic resins, which provide superior bonding strength and water resistance. The term “boiling waterproof” indicates that the plywood can endure boiling water without delaminating or losing its structural integrity.

Manufacturing Process of BWP Plywood

The manufacturing process of BWP plywood involves several critical steps to ensure its high quality and water resistance.

1. Selection of Raw Materials

High-quality hardwood veneers are selected for the production of BWP plywood. These veneers are carefully inspected for any defects or imperfections.

2. Bonding with Phenolic Resins

The veneers are then bonded together using phenolic resins, which are known for their excellent adhesive properties and water resistance. The resin is applied evenly to ensure a strong bond between the layers.

3. Hot Pressing

The bonded veneers are subjected to high pressure and temperature in a hot press. This process ensures that the resin cures properly, resulting in a strong and durable plywood sheet.

4. Quality Control

Each sheet of BWP plywood undergoes rigorous quality control tests to ensure it meets the required standards. These tests include checking for water resistance, strength, and durability.

Applications of BWP Plywood

BWP plywood is widely used in various applications due to its exceptional properties. Some of the common applications include:

1. Outdoor Furniture

BWP plywood is ideal for making outdoor furniture such as garden benches, picnic tables, and patio chairs. Its high water resistance ensures that the furniture remains in good condition even when exposed to rain and humidity.

2. Marine Applications

BWP plywood is commonly used in marine applications such as boat building and dock construction. Its ability to withstand prolonged exposure to water makes it a preferred choice for these applications.

3. Kitchen Cabinets

Due to its moisture resistance, BWP plywood is also used in the construction of kitchen cabinets. It ensures that the cabinets remain durable and free from warping or swelling.

4. Bathroom Fixtures

BWP plywood is used in the construction of bathroom fixtures such as vanities and storage units. Its water resistance properties make it suitable for high-moisture environments.

5. Construction

BWP plywood is used in various construction applications, including formwork, scaffolding, and roofing. Its strength and durability make it a reliable material for these purposes.

Disadvantages of Using BWP Plywood

1. Higher Cost

BWP plywood is generally more expensive than other types of plywood due to its high-quality materials and manufacturing process.

2. Weight

BWP plywood is heavier than standard plywood, which can make it more challenging to handle and transport.

3. Limited Availability

BWP plywood may not be readily available in all regions, which can make it difficult to source.

Maintenance and Care of BWP Plywood

1. Regular Cleaning

To maintain the appearance and durability of BWP plywood, it is important to clean it regularly. Use a mild detergent and water to remove dirt and grime.

2. Avoid Prolonged Exposure to Direct Sunlight

While BWP plywood is highly resistant to moisture, prolonged exposure to direct sunlight can cause it to fade or degrade over time. Use protective coatings or finishes to prevent this.

3. Inspect for Damage

Regularly inspect the plywood for any signs of damage, such as cracks or delamination. Address any issues promptly to prevent further deterioration.

4. Apply Protective Coatings

Applying protective coatings such as varnish or paint can enhance the durability and appearance of BWP plywood. These coatings also provide an additional layer of protection against moisture and UV rays.

Frequently Asked Questions (FAQs)

1. What is the difference between BWP plywood and MR plywood?

BWP plywood is specifically designed to withstand boiling water and extreme moisture, making it suitable for outdoor and marine applications. MR (Moisture Resistant) plywood, on the other hand, is designed to resist moisture but not to the same extent as BWP plywood.

2. Can BWP plywood be used for indoor applications?

Yes, BWP plywood can be used for indoor applications, especially in areas with high moisture levels such as kitchens and bathrooms.

3. How long does BWP plywood last?

With proper maintenance and care, BWP plywood can last for many years, even in harsh environments.

4. Is BWP plywood termite-proof?

While BWP plywood is resistant to termites and other pests, it is not completely termite-proof. Regular inspections and treatments may be necessary to prevent termite infestations.

5. Can BWP plywood be painted?

Yes, BWP plywood can be painted or varnished to enhance its appearance and provide additional protection against moisture and UV rays.

6. What is the cost of BWP plywood?

The cost of BWP plywood varies depending on the grade, thickness, and brand. It is generally more expensive than standard plywood due to its high-quality materials and manufacturing process.

7. Is BWP plywood eco-friendly?

Many manufacturers of BWP plywood are committed to sustainable sourcing practices and use low VOC emissions resins, making it an environmentally friendly option.

8. Can BWP plywood be used for flooring?

Yes, BWP plywood can be used for flooring, especially in areas with high moisture levels such as bathrooms and kitchens.

9. How do I identify high-quality BWP plywood?

High-quality BWP plywood will have fewer defects, a smooth surface, and a strong bond between the layers. It is also important to choose a reputable brand and check for certifications.

10. What are the alternatives to BWP plywood?

Alternatives to BWP plywood include MR plywood, marine plywood, and treated plywood. However, these alternatives may not offer the same level of water resistance and durability as BWP plywood.
